We again consider the problem of recovering the Earth's internal magnetic f
ield B knowing its intensity \\B\\ at the Earth's surface and the location
of the dip equator. In the present paper we focus on estimating the differe
nce between two solutions B obtained from imperfect data. We explicitly est
imate this difference and show that it converges to zero when the errors on
\\B\\ and on the location of the dig equator E both tend to zero.
